Quick Answer
A shortwave radio can be a viable means of remote area communication, allowing users to transmit and receive messages over long distances, provided they have the proper equipment and technical knowledge.
Choosing the Right Shortwave Radio
When selecting a shortwave radio for remote area communication, consider the frequency range, power output, and antenna options. A good starting point is a radio with a frequency range of 1-30 MHz, which covers the standard shortwave bands. For example, the Icom IC-7300 or the Yaesu FT-891 are popular choices among amateur radio operators. These radios typically have a power output of 100-200 watts, which is sufficient for long-distance communication.
Setting Up Your Shortwave Radio
To set up a shortwave radio for remote area communication, you’ll need to choose an antenna that suits your needs. A dipole antenna is a good option for beginners, as it’s relatively easy to set up and has a moderate gain. A more advanced option is a Yagi antenna, which has a higher gain but requires more expertise to set up. It’s essential to use a sturdy antenna mount and ensure proper grounding to prevent damage from lightning strikes or other environmental factors.
Operating Your Shortwave Radio
To operate your shortwave radio effectively, you’ll need to learn basic techniques such as frequency scanning, Morse code transmission, and antenna tuning. Practice communicating with other amateur radio operators to get a feel for the equipment and the signals. It’s also essential to follow proper etiquette and regulations, such as using call signs, respecting frequency allocations, and reporting any interference or issues. By mastering these skills and techniques, you can establish reliable communication in remote areas using your shortwave radio.
